Is there a need for you to look for hotels in Makkah and Madinah?
If you intend to perform Umra the licensed agent, through whom you get your visa, usually arrange the package for you. A good agent will allow you to choose the standard and get it for you.
Those arranging visa only will, name you hotels, but leave you to make the arrangement of booking yourself.
To get rooms in a 5 star hotel in Makkah is next to impossible be that through a licensed agent or direct.

Seems like you managed very well last year. This year should be no different except that the agent who got you your visa "may" require you to give him hotel confirmation so that he can satisfy his contractor's demand as per the latest ministry of haj's regulations.
Mention my name to Iqbal Bhaimiya and see what he says !!!!!!! Tell him to organise your hotel confirmation for you.
I suggest you stick with Dallah Taiyaba in Madinah - although this one now needs serious refurbishment - as it is very close to the Haram and reasonably priced.
Alternatively, if you want better standard with similar rates try "Al Harithiya" or "Diyar Al Khair" (Al Andalus group) both of which are similar distance but much much more superior in standard.
In Makkah, the Firdaus Group hotel's advantage is their close proximity to the Haram otherwise there is nothing else about them to write home about or posting on this forum !!!!
Better standard hotels and REALLY 4 Star, in Makkah are:
Dar Nadwa (Al Masa Group) behind Hilton.
Dar As Salam..(leased by Malaysians) behind Elaf Kindah in Misfala..Very good.
Elaf Al Huda with doors on both Khalid bin Walid and Jabal Kaba streets.
3 Star standard and cheaper then Firdaus Group are:
Al Jazeera on Khalid Bin Walid.
Aziz Plaza on Jabal Kaba.
Al Moazzin on Khalid Bin Walid.
Al Masa'a (Not Al Masa) in Misfala after Bakka Baiti.
Al Maqam on Ajyad Al Soud facing the Royal Palace.
